It's an interesting idea, and I'm trying to figure out a list. Problem I'm having is Bulwark's requirement that the models be in B2B. With Purifiers not hitting especially hard, I'd want at least one heavy (which Bulwark makes 2 heavies), but Purifiers outpace nearly every heavy in Menoth.
So overall it's a difficult problem to solve.
That said, I do think it'd be best in Exemplar Interdiction, both for the Blessed weapons on the Purifiers and the extra 2" deployment, which Durst really wants.

Aaaaand right after saying all that, I came up with something to try.
Durst +28 Hierophant 3 Purifier x4 32 Sanctifier x2 28 Wrack 1 Vassal Mechanik 1 Vassal of Menoth x2 6 Exemplar Warder 0 max Choir 6 Knights Exemplar 9 UA 4 Knights Exemplar 9 UA 4
Idea is that the Purifiers and Sanctifiers run B2B in a line in front of the Knights, blocking LoS. Purifiers are (as stated in original post) DEF17 ARM18 at range, Sanctifiers are DEF14 ARM21. Jacks serve as the front line, using the feat to ensure they make it to combat and/or survive first round of combat, then Knights come in after to clean up.
I'm concerned about scenario, as I always am with Durst. Any scenario that forces you to spread out is a big issue, as are jamming infantry. That said, it'd be interesting to try.

Post by mydnight on Jul 31, 2018 9:16:09 GMT
I wanted to try it out in FM (theme benefits are nice) but I think the new EI has a lot of pros, namely warder, Sev0 and FoS. CM isn't so great because Durst actually needs some infantry and doesn't run a heap of jacks all that well. Sev0+boundless charge can get a jack surprisingly deep into enemy lines (something I like with Rezzie2). FM still has some pros of course, namely nice solos, idrians, deliverers and sunbursts, which is great for unjamming your jackwall.
